Officers struck in possible hit-and-run near Lombard StBaltimore MD

E Lombard St, Baltimore, MD 21224

As discussed during the dispatch call, dispatch audio describes a possible hit-and-run incident in which a silver Toyota Corolla with New York plates struck two officers near Boston Street before fleeing. The vehicle was later located near Lombard Street. A 'Signal 13' call indicated officers required assistance, and medical services were ordered. The situation appeared to involve search and coordination among police units to locate the vehicle.
